    A South African politician has alleged that a controversial businessman threatened to kill him if he ever disclosed that he have been offered a bribe to transform finance minister.

    Mcebisi Jonas made the revelation at an inquiry into alleged corruption while ex-President Jacob Zuma was once in office.

    it’s investigating if the rich Gupta circle of relatives influenced political selections, including naming ministers.

    Ajay Gupta has denied that he ever meet Mr Jonas or presented him a bribe.

    Accusations of graft dogged Mr Zuma’s presidency ahead of he used to be pressured to step down in February.

    Mr Jonas also said that Mr Gupta mentioned then-President Zuma was once on the bidding of the rich Indian-born family.

    “He stated: ‘You should keep in mind that we are in control of the whole thing – the Nationwide Prosecuting Authority, the Hawks an elite police unit, the Nationwide Intelligence Company and the antique guy Zuma will do the rest we tell him to do,’” he instructed the commission.

    In December, South Africa’s Prime Courtroom ordered that the inquiry be set up within the wake of the public protector’s document, referred to as State of Seize, which found evidence of conceivable corruption on the most sensible stage of Mr Zuma’s government.

    The Zondo Fee, which began its hearings this week, does not have energy to prosecute however it can compel other folks to offer evidence.

    Any evidence it collects will also be utilized in any long term prosecutions, despite the fact that it could absorb to 2 years to unlock its findings.

    A public inquiry in South Africa has started investigating alleged corruption by means of ex-President Jacob Zuma.

    The inquiry is asking into “state capture”, the place the wealthy Gupta family is accused of trying to persuade political selections, together with the naming of ministers.

    Accusations of graft dogged Mr Zuma’s presidency ahead of he was pressured to step down in February.

    The former president and the Gupta circle of relatives deny any wrongdoing.

    Mr Zuma used to be ordered to set up the commission by way of the high courtroom last December following a file through the public protector, South Africa’s anti-graft body.

    It had discovered proof of conceivable corruption on the top level of his government.

    One of the allegations is that in 2015 then-Deputy Finance Minister Mcebisi Jonas used to be presented 600m rand ($41m; £32m) by way of businessman Ajay Gupta if he accepted the put up of finance minister.

    Mr Jonas is expected to be among the first witnesses to offer proof.

    The inquiry, referred to as the Zondo Fee, doesn’t have powers to prosecute but the evidence it collects will also be utilized in any future prosecution.

    it will absorb to 2 years to free up its findings.
